A new study from the University of Florida tests five top commercial AI text detectors and finds them highly unreliable. False positive rates range from 0.05% to 68.6%, while false negative rates hit up to 99.6%. The researchers warn that academic institutions risk career-altering mistakes by relying on these tools without proper validation.

A new study from UC San Diego shows that advanced AI models like GPT-4.5 can pass the Turing Test in live chat settings, outperforming human participants at convincing judges they are real. The findings highlight the growing ability of AI to mimic human conversation, raising concerns about authenticity in digital interactions. The study used a three-party setup where judges chatted with both a human and an AI, then identified the human. GPT-4.5 succeeded 73% of the time when given a persona prompt, and LLaMa-3.1-405B crossed a striking 56% threshold. This research challenges assumptions about machine capability and signals a new frontier in AI-human communication.
